Family-Friendly Fun at the Museum
The third annual Halloween Night at the Museum at Tomball Museum Center is a must-do. Scheduled for October 25 from 4:30 p.m. to 7:30 p.m., this free event features trick-or-treat stations, crafts, and a scavenger hunt, making it a perfect evening for families. You’re encouraged to dress in costume as you enjoy a stress-free evening filled with spooky family activities!
